Summary

Robert F. Kennedy Jr. has initiated a significant shift in federal nutrition policy as head of Health and Human Services, leading the “Make America Healthy Again” movement. Changes include a focus on whole foods, full-fat dairy consumption, and a backlash against seed oils. Additionally, Kennedy announced a phase-out of synthetic dyes in food, encouraged high protein intake, and targets high-fructose corn syrup. Despite these changes, experts note that affordability of ultra-processed foods will continue to influence consumer choices.
